Before You Go
Dress modestly for sacred sites
Wear shoulders- and knee-covering clothing and carry a scarf to enter mosques and gurdwaras; some sites require head coverings for both men and women.
Remove shoes at entry
Be prepared to take off shoes at temples and gurudwaras—bring easy-to-remove footwear or a small bag to carry them.
Stay hydrated and pace the heat
Delhi’s heat and humidity can be intense; carry water and plan visits in the cooler morning or late afternoon hours when possible.
Allow transit buffer
Traffic on Delhi roads can be unpredictable—build extra time between stops and for airport transfers.

Conservation Note
Visitors should respect water and waste practices at religious sites—avoid single-use plastics where possible and follow on-site rules to protect communal spaces.
The tour stitches an arc from Mughal Delhi (Jama Masjid) to modern civic architecture along Rajpath; Rashtrapati Bhavan and India Gate reflect colonial-era and wartime memorial history.
